Authorities in Ghadames have completed 90% of the reconstruction work at the Dibdab border crossing with Algeria, says Ghadames's Mayor, Qasim Al-Manea.

The remaining procedures will be completed within the next two days, the mayor said, noting that they will hold a meeting with the Algerian side to agree on a mechanism for operating the crossing point and resume the traffic and trade movement between the two countries.

On Thursday, Libya's Ministry of Interior held an expanded meeting to review and assess the operational needs of the crossing point in preparation for its opening.

Thursday's meeting reviewed the operational needs at the legal, administrative, technical, and service levels in order to refer the recommendations to the concerned authorities to complete the remaining communication arrangements.

The Algerian authorities decided last May to reopen the border crossing with Libya for commercial purposes only, which would allow export operations between the two states.
